Your website is one of the most powerful tools for increasing Donor Advised Fund (DAF) donations. In this guide, you'll find tips and examples for how to effectively feature DAFpay on both a dedicated page and a general "Ways to Give" page.
π Pro Tip: We recommend including two DAFpay CTAs β a button and a tile β to allow donors to give instantly or scroll for more information. See Leukemia & Lymphoma Society for a great example.

3. π Create a Vanity Link
Once your DAF giving page is finalized, create a custom vanity URL for marketing and donor outreach.
Example: http://aclu.org/daf
This makes it easier to link from email campaigns, social posts, or printed materials.
